3M VHB Vs. Gorilla Tape: Specs & Uses
🌡️Temperature Resistance
3M VHB: 300°F intermittent, 200°F continuous
Gorilla Tape: Continuous to 194°F intermittent to 302°F
🆚Best Materials
3M VHB: Metals, glass, plastics, powder coated paints
Gorilla Tape: Smooth and rough surfaces, plastic, metal, wood, glass, brick, ceramic, stone
🛠️Common Uses
3M VHB eliminates the need for drilling holes or using traditional fasteners; securely attaches displays, signage, or lightweight structures without causing damage to surfaces.
Gorilla Tape can be used to securely attach lightweight objects such as picture frames, small mirrors, or decorative items to smooth surfaces like painted walls, glass, or tile.

My Hands-on Test of Gorilla Heavy-Duty Mounting Tape
✅incredibly Strong Bond
This tape forms an incredibly strong bond that can potentially pull off paint or damage surfaces if you try to remove it later. So think carefully about placement before applying!
That being said, the permanent nature of this tape makes it ideal for a variety of heavy-duty mounting applications, both indoors and outdoors. I’ve used it to permanently mount things like screens, signs, artwork, acoustic foam panels, and more to walls and other surfaces with great success. The key is having enough surface area for the adhesive to fully adhere.

Mounting Objects to Concrete
One area where this tape really shines is mounting objects to concrete, brick, or cinder block. I’ve mounted wooden furniture legs to bathroom floors, plastic sheathing to crawl space walls, and artwork directly to cinder block walls – all with Gorilla Tape holding strong. It can definitely handle moisture exposure too.

For outdoor applications like mounting cameras or lights, Gorilla Tape is up to the task. It can withstand extreme cold down to -40°F without losing its grip. I’ve attached cameras, solar lights, and more around the exterior of my home using this heavy-duty tape.
The tape also works great for adhering to certain plastics, rubber, wood, metal, and more. I’ve used it to reinforce command hook mounting on walls and secure a dash cam to my car’s windshield without any damage upon removal. However, it is not recommended for polyethylene or polypropylene plastics.
❌Cons
There are some applications where Gorilla Tape is not ideal though. It cannot support objects deeper than 0.75 inches, so larger hangings like a medicine cabinet or pelican case are too heavy. It’s also not meant for bonding fabrics, so I wouldn’t use it for hemming pants or similar fabric projects. Gorilla explicitly advises against using this tape inside clothes dryers as well.
If you do need to remove this heavy-duty tape eventually, heat can help loosen the adhesive according to some users. But be very careful, as improper removal could damage surfaces. In general, I recommend planning for permanent mounting with this product.

My Hands-on Test of 3M VHB Tape
✅Pros: 3M VHB Tape
One of the standout features of the genuine 3M tape is its ability to adhere to various surfaces. I have successfully used it on smooth surfaces such as glass, wood, and plastic with excellent results. Whether it was sticking my phone mount to the dashboard or holding batteries together for my UPS, this tape demonstrated its strength and durability. It can withstand a wide range of temperatures, from freezing conditions to scorching hot summers exceeding 115°F. I highly recommend opting for the larger 36-yard roll instead of the smaller ones, as the quality is superior and it provides better value for your money.
In my experience, the 3M VHB tape has been a reliable choice for bonding various materials, akin to welding. I have successfully used it to bond powder-coated aluminum parts, providing a strong and secure connection. However, it’s important to note that once this tape is applied, it becomes extremely difficult to remove. It’s a testament to its adhesive power, but it also means that you need to be mindful of the application process and ensure proper alignment before committing to the bond.

FAQ of 3M VHB Tape
Q: Can it adhere to different types of fabrics?
A: The ability of this foam tape to stick to various fabrics varies. Generally speaking, it is not well-suited for most fabric materials. It achieves optimal performance when applied to solid, smooth surfaces such as metals, certain hard plastics, and sealed wood. Without specific details about the type of fabric, its application, or the bonding requirements, it becomes challenging to provide tailored recommendations for tape alternatives. However, if you are not dealing with specialized fabrics, you might consider exploring the possibility of using adhesive transfer tape instead.
